WebSalvador Minuchin, a psychoanalyst, was a significant contributor to the creation of Structural Family Therapy. He, together with Jay Haley, Claudio Naranjo, and James Framo, came up with the idea in the 1960s. Minuchin was the key figure in the development of. Structural Family Therapy. WebFamily systems theory (Kerr and Bowen, 1988) is a theory of human behavior that defines the family unit as a complex social system, in which members interact to influence each other's behavior.
